

Thinkific to Zen cart
Migrating your store from Thinkific to Zen cart might seem daunting, but with proper planning and the right tools, it's a smooth process. Follow this step-by-step guide to ensure a successful transition.
Schedule a callStep-by-Step Migration Guide: Thinkific to Zen Cart migration guide
Step 1: Assess Your Current Thinkific Setup
In this initial step, we will conduct a thorough assessment of your existing Thinkific setup to identify the courses, user data, and content that need to be migrated to Zen Cart.
Step 2: Backup Your Thinkific Data
We will perform a full backup of your Thinkific data to safeguard against any loss during the migration process.
Step 3: Prepare Zen Cart for Migration
We will set up your Zen Cart environment to ensure it is ready to receive your Thinkific data.
Step 4: Migrate Course Content to Zen Cart
We will meticulously transfer your Thinkific course content to Zen Cart, ensuring all details are accurately reflected.
Step 5: Import User Data into Zen Cart
We will import your Thinkific user data into Zen Cart to maintain continuity for your existing students.
Step 6: Test and Validate the Migration
We will conduct thorough testing of the migrated data and content to ensure everything functions correctly.
Step 7: Launch Your Zen Cart Store
We will officially launch your Zen Cart store, making your courses available to users with all features functioning properly.
Power Your Step - Get in Touch
Contact us at PowerCommerce to leverage our expertise in seamless migrations and elevate your e-commerce experience.
Step 1: Assess Your Current Thinkific Setup
Before we initiate the migration process, it is essential to conduct a comprehensive assessment of your current Thinkific setup. This step provides a clear understanding of what needs to be transferred to Zen Cart, ensuring a seamless transition.
Start by logging into your Thinkific account and reviewing the following:
- Courses: List all active courses, including their titles, descriptions, media files, and any associated quizzes or resources.
- User Data: Export a list of all user accounts, including their enrollment status, progress, and certifications, if applicable.
- Content Types: Categorize the types of content you have--videos, PDFs, quizzes, etc.--to determine the best way to recreate this content in Zen Cart.
Once you have a comprehensive overview, document the specifics, such as URLs to content, pricing structures, and any unique features your courses offer. This documentation will serve as a blueprint for your migration and help us avoid losing any vital information during the transition.

Step 2: Backup Your Thinkific Data
Backing up your data is a critical step before proceeding with any migration. This ensures that you have a copy of your original content and user data in case anything goes awry during the transfer to Zen Cart.
To back up your Thinkific data, follow these steps:
- Export Courses: Navigate to the 'Manage Learning Content' section in Thinkific. Select each course and use the export feature to download course content, including text, video, and attachments.
- Download User Data: Go to the 'Manage Students' tab and export your student list as a CSV file, ensuring you include all relevant details such as user progress and enrollment dates.
- Collect Financial Data: If applicable, export your sales reports for any financial records associated with your courses.
Storing this data in a secure location, such as a cloud storage solution or external hard drive, will provide peace of mind as we proceed with the migration.

Step 3: Prepare Zen Cart for Migration
Setting up your Zen Cart environment is a crucial step in the migration process. This involves installing Zen Cart on your server and configuring key settings to accommodate your e-learning business.
Here’s how we can prepare Zen Cart for your migration:
- Choose a Hosting Provider: Select a reliable hosting provider that supports Zen Cart. Ensure they meet the requirements for PHP and MySQL.
- Install Zen Cart: Use the one-click installation feature typically offered by hosting providers, or download the Zen Cart package and follow the installation guide on their official site.
- Configure Settings: After installation, log into the admin panel to configure settings such as currency, payment options, shipping methods, and product categories that will align with your courses and content.
By ensuring that your Zen Cart is correctly set up, we can facilitate a smoother migration of your data and content.

Step 4: Migrate Course Content to Zen Cart
With your Zen Cart environment prepared, we can now begin migrating your course content from Thinkific. This step involves recreating your course structures, product listings, and all associated content in Zen Cart.
Follow these steps to ensure a successful migration:
- Create Product Listings: For each course, create a corresponding product listing in Zen Cart. Include all relevant information such as course title, description, and pricing.
- Upload Course Materials: Upload videos, PDFs, and other course materials to the Zen Cart product pages. Ensure that all media files are properly linked and accessible to users.
- Set Up User Access: Configure user access settings for your courses, determining whether they will be available for one-time purchase, subscriptions, or memberships.
During this migration, we need to ensure that all content is formatted correctly and that links to resources function as intended. Testing each course after migration is essential for a smooth transition.

Step 5: Import User Data into Zen Cart
Importing user data is a vital step to ensure that your existing students can access their courses on the new platform without disruption.
Here’s how we can import user data into Zen Cart:
- Prepare User CSV File: Format the CSV file obtained from Thinkific to match the requirements of Zen Cart. This may involve organizing columns for first name, last name, email, and any other relevant attributes.
- Use Zen Cart Import Tools: Utilize Zen Cart's built-in import tools or appropriate plugins that facilitate CSV importation. Follow the prompts to upload your user data.
- Verify User Accounts: After importing, verify that all user accounts are correctly created in Zen Cart and that their details match those from Thinkific.
Maintaining your user base’s integrity during migration is crucial for preserving relationships and ensuring a positive user experience.

Step 6: Test and Validate the Migration
After successful migrations of both course content and user data, the next critical step is to thoroughly test and validate the entire setup in Zen Cart.
Testing involves several key actions:
- Check Course Access: Log in as a test user to ensure that you can access all courses and materials without issues.
- Test Payment Processing: Simulate transactions to verify that payment gateways are functioning correctly and that users can complete purchases smoothly.
- Review User Experience: Navigate through the user interface to identify any potential usability issues. Ensure that navigation, search functions, and course access points are user-friendly.
Document any issues encountered during testing and address them promptly to ensure a seamless experience for your users upon launch.

Step 7: Launch Your Zen Cart Store
With all testing completed and issues resolved, we are ready to launch your Zen Cart store. This step involves several final preparations to ensure everything is in order before your audience accesses the new platform.
Here’s how to prepare for the launch:
- Final Review: Conduct a comprehensive review of your Zen Cart store, ensuring that all content is accurate and formatted correctly.
- Announce the Launch: Prepare announcements to inform your existing student base about the new Zen Cart platform, highlighting any new features or changes they should be aware of.
- Monitor Performance: After launching, closely monitor the store's performance, user activity, and feedback to quickly address any arising issues.
Launching your Zen Cart store marks a significant milestone in your e-learning journey, and we are here to support you every step of the way.

Power Your Step - Get in Touch
If you're ready to take the next step in your e-commerce journey, we at PowerCommerce are here to help. Our team specializes in platform migrations, ensuring a smooth transition to Zen Cart or any other platform you choose.
Here’s how you can get in touch with us:
- Visit our contact page: https://powercommerce.com/contact
- Call us at 800-099-9090 for immediate assistance.
- Email us at info@powercommerce.com with your inquiry.
With over 15 years of industry expertise, we are committed to empowering your e-commerce brand with cutting-edge solutions tailored to your specific needs. Don’t hesitate--reach out today and let’s power your step toward success!
Stay aligned on what's happening in the commerce world

Trusted by 1000+ innovative companies worldwide
Schedule Your Migration Today
For businesses prioritizing simplicity, scalability, and robust support, Shopify is the clear winner.
Looking to migrate without hassle? Power Commerce can handle the entire process, ensuring smooth data transfer, store setup, and post-launch success.
Marka Marulića 2, Sarajevo, 71000 BiH
00387 60 345 5801
info@powercommerce.com